Your screen makes colour with light; a printing press makes colour with ink. RGB mixes red, green and blue light and can reach around 16.7 million colours. CMYK mixes cyan, magenta, yellow and black ink and reaches roughly half that. When you send an RGB file to a press, every colour that exists only in the screen's range has to be swapped for the nearest ink mix that does exist — and that swap is why your electric blue arrives purple, your neon green arrives olive, and your logo looks slightly wrong on 5,000 flyers you have already paid for.

The two colour models, in one paragraph each

RGB is additive. A screen starts black and adds light. Add all three channels at full strength and you get white. Because light can be emitted at high intensity, screens produce colours — vivid cyans, saturated oranges, glowing greens — that simply have no ink equivalent. RGB is correct for websites, social media, presentations and anything viewed on a device.

CMYK is subtractive. A press starts with white paper and lays down ink that subtracts light. Cyan, magenta and yellow theoretically combine to black, but in practice they produce a muddy brown, so a fourth plate — K, for key — carries true black and shadow detail. CMYK is correct for anything printed on paper: business cards, flyers, brochures, packaging.

Which colours break, and how badly

Not everything shifts. Corporate navy, burgundy, most greys, skin tones and warm reds convert almost invisibly. The problems cluster in predictable places:

  • Bright blue → purple. The most common complaint in the industry. Screen blues around #0000FF sit far outside the CMYK gamut, and the press substitutes a mix heavy in magenta. If your brand blue is very saturated, expect a visible shift unless it is corrected manually.
  • Neon and fluorescent anything. Neon green, hot pink, safety orange — these are emitted-light colours. There is no four-colour ink recipe for them. They will print as a duller, flatter version of themselves every time.
  • Rich saturated greens. They lose intensity and drift towards olive.
  • Deep blacks in large areas. Black set to 100% K alone prints as a washed grey-black over a large panel. For panels bigger than a business card, use a rich black build — a common press-safe recipe is C60 M40 Y40 K100.
  • Small black text. The opposite rule. Body text must be 100% K only. Four-colour black text goes fuzzy the moment the plates are half a hair out of register.

What actually happens to an RGB file at the press

If you send an RGB PDF, it does not get rejected — it gets converted, either by the print software or the RIP, using a default profile you never chose. That is the real risk. The conversion is automatic, it is invisible to you, and it happens after your last chance to look at the result.

Convert the file yourself and you keep control: you see the shift on your own screen, you decide whether the shifted colour is acceptable, and you adjust the values you care about most — usually the logo — before anything is committed to plate. Same press, same paper, completely different outcome.

The five-minute artwork check

  1. Set the document colour mode to CMYK before you start designing, not at the end. In Illustrator and InDesign this is a document setting; in Photoshop it is Image › Mode › CMYK Color.
  2. Soft-proof. Use View › Proof Setup to preview the CMYK result while working. Colours that jump when you toggle the proof are the ones that will disappoint you in print.
  3. Check the gamut warning in the colour picker. If it flags your brand colour, decide now what it becomes rather than letting software decide later.
  4. Fix your blacks. Body text and small type: 100% K. Large black backgrounds: rich black. Never both in the same panel — the mismatch is visible.
  5. Check total ink coverage. Keep the sum of C+M+Y+K under about 300% on coated stock. Above that, ink stops drying properly and sheets can offset onto each other in the stack.
  6. Export as PDF/X-1a or PDF/X-4 with fonts embedded and images at 300 dpi. These formats flatten transparency predictably and lock the colour space.

Pantone, brand colours and what to do when the shift is unacceptable

If your brand colour is genuinely outside CMYK reach and the conversion is not acceptable — a common problem for tech companies and beverage brands with vivid identities — you have three practical routes:

  1. Accept a corrected CMYK build. Instead of accepting the automatic conversion, manually specify the closest CMYK values you find acceptable and lock them into your brand guidelines. Most UAE companies do this once and reuse the values forever.

Frequently asked questions

Why did my blue logo print purple?

Because saturated screen blue sits outside the CMYK gamut and the automatic conversion adds magenta to reach it. Fix it by converting the file yourself and manually reducing the magenta in your blue build until it looks right in soft proof. Then save those CMYK values in your brand guidelines so it never happens again.

Can I just send an RGB file?

You can, and it will print — but the conversion then happens with default settings you never saw. On simple work with muted colours the difference is often invisible. On anything with a saturated brand colour, convert it yourself first.

Will the same file print identically on flyers and business cards?

Close, but not identical. Coated glossy stock, uncoated stock and laminated board absorb and reflect ink differently, so the same CMYK values look slightly different across substrates. If exact matching across items matters, print them in one order.

What resolution do images need to be?

300 dpi at final print size. An image that looks sharp on a website is usually 72 dpi and will look soft on paper. Scaling a 72 dpi image up in the layout does not add detail.

How do I get a true gold or silver?

Foil stamping or metallic ink — not CMYK. A four-colour attempt at gold prints as a flat mustard brown. Gold foil with spot UV on a 400 GSM card is AED 359 per 1,000.

What is rich black and when should I use it?

Rich black is black built from all four inks, typically around C60 M40 Y40 K100, and it is used for large solid black areas where 100% K alone looks grey. Keep small text and thin lines at 100% K only to avoid registration fuzziness.
